The four largest companies actively participating in the Asia-Pacific antibiotic resistance market include Merck & Co. Inc., Pfizer Inc., Johnson & Johnson, and GlaxoSmithKline (GSK). Merck & Co. Inc. and Pfizer leverage extensive global surveillance networks and diversified antibiotic pipelines, focusing on antimicrobial innovation and stewardship in the APAC region. Johnson & Johnson emphasizes tuberculosis resistance solutions, a major concern in countries like India and China. GSK leads in antimicrobial R&D with a robust pipeline targeting priority pathogens and antibiotic stewardship programs supporting appropriate use.
These companies benefit from Asia-Pacific's rapidly growing market, projected to reach over USD 3.5 billion by 2030, driven by increasing antibiotic-resistant infections and expanding healthcare infrastructure. They engage in partnerships, technological innovation including AI, and focus on diseases such as hospital-acquired infections and multi-drug resistant tuberculosis prevalent in the region. Government initiatives and rising infection rates fuel demand, making these players critical contributors to combating antibiotic resistance through new drug development and stewardship efforts across Asia-Pacific.
